Summary
Set in seventeenth-century Iran, The Blood of Flowers is the powerful and haunting story of a young girl's journey from innocence to adulthood. On the sudden death of her father, our heroine and her mother fall upon hard times and are forced to travel to the bustling city of Isfahan where relatives take them in. Everything is new: the grudging charity of her aunt, the encouragement of her uncle, the treacherous friendship of the daughter of rich neighbours. And there's an adventure ahead which will introduce her to the sensual side of life as well as to the cruelty of betrayal and rejection before she finds her way to contentment and possibly, even, to happiness.
